display y1731 eth-test

Function

The display y1731 eth-test command displays ETH-test configurations on a MEP that initiates an ETH-test instance.

Format

display y1731 eth-test md md-name ma ma-name mep mep-id

Parameters

Parameter Description Value
ma ma-name

Displays ETH-test configurations in a specified MA.

The value is a string of 1 to 43 characters, and hyphens (-) or question marks (?) are not supported.

mep mep-id

Displays ETH-test configurations on a specified MEP.

The value is an integer ranging from 1 to 8191.

md md-name

Displays ETH-test configurations in a specified MD.

The value is a string of 1 to 43 characters, and hyphens (-) or question marks (?) are not supported.

Views

All views

Default Level

1: Monitoring level

Task Name and Operations

Task Name Operations
y1731 read

Usage Guidelines

Usage Scenario

To view ETH-test configurations on a MEP that initiates an ETH-test instance, run the display y1731 eth-test command.

Example

The actual command output varies according to the device. The command output here is only an example.

# Display ETH-test configurations on MEP1.
<HUAWEI> display y1731 eth-test md md1 ma ma1 mep 1
The total number of Eth-Test is : 1
--------------------------------------------------
 MD Name            : md1
 MA Name            : ma1
 MEP ID             : 1
 Sending            : Yes
 Remote MEP ID      : 2
 Mac                : --
 Rate               : 50000 kbps
 Timeout            : 300 s
 Pattern            : zero-no-crc
 8021p              : 255
 Packet Size        : 64 bytes
 Out of Service     : Disabled
 Lck Level          : --
 Send Count:        : 11653726
 Send Rate          : no result
 Send Time          : --
Table 1 Description of the display y1731 eth-test command output
Item Description
MD Name

Name of an MD.

MA Name

Name of an MA.

MEP ID

ID of a MEP that initiates a test.

Sending

Whether a MEP is enabled to send test packets:

  • Yes.
  • No.
Remote MEP ID

RMEP ID.

Mac

MAC address carried in test packets.

Rate

Send rate.

Timeout

Timeout period, in seconds.

Pattern

TLV type:

  • zero-no-crc: No CRC-32 value follows the all-zeros code type in a Test TLV.
  • zero-crc: A CRC-32 value follows the all-zeros code type in a Test TLV.
8021p

Priority value in sent packets.

Packet Size

Packet size, in bytes.

Out of Service

Whether the out of service mode is enabled:

  • Enable.
  • Disabled.
Lck Level

ETH-LCK packet level when the out of service mode is enabled.

Send Count

Number of sent packets in the existing ETH-test instance.

Send Rate

Actual rate (in kbit/s) at which packets are sent.

Send Time

Send time.
